Document 1800Nourse requested estimate of expenditures of military department for volunteer cavalry and infantry to suppress insurrection in Northampton County, Pennsylvania in 1799, Simmons replied with details. Total amount: $26,424.94. Amount did not include compensation for regular troops.

[Accountants Office?]
Joseph Nourse Esq
Register of the Treasury &c
&c
March 16 1800
I enclose your note of Friday last requesting and Estimate of the expenditures of the late Insurrection in Pennsylvania which Shews that you will receive herewith amounting to Twenty six thousand four hundred twenty four dollars & ninety four Cents.
Sam &c
W.S.
( Estimate of expenditures in the Military Department on the volunteer Cavalry & Infantry called into service by the President of the United States to suppress an Insurrection in the County of Northumberland State of Pennsylvania in the Year 1799 —
For Pay & Forage of the Cavalry & Pay of the Infantry
as entered on the books of this Office — Dol 23491.99
For subsistance of Do. — — — 559.63
For subsistance of a belonging nature — — — 188.—
for amount paid to be expended in the Dept of the
Quarto master General — — — — — 2782.12
to which add this from being amount supposed to be
due for forage claimed on said detachments & wholes
have not been exhibited for liquidation at this Office: 600.—
Dollars — 7 6621.94
This above does not include any compensations to the Regular
troops employed on the said Expedition —
